MACEDON, Kingdom of Philip III Arrhidaios, (323-317 B.C.), silver tetradrachm, (17.18 g), Pella mint, issued under Antipater or Polyperchon, 323-318/7 B.C., obv. head of Herakles to right with lion skin, dotted border, rev. Zeus seated to left, eagle in outstretched hand, to right **ALEXANDROU*, Corinthian helmet on left to left, dotted border, (cf.S.6749, Price 212, M.191, SNG Ash. 3164). Bright surfaces, nearly extremely fine and well struck.

Ex George Mihailuk Collection, acquired from Richard Welling 15.8.2008.
